The module works with networking switches and routers that support QSFP+ optical transceivers. It is commonly deployed in Arista switches and other enterprise networking equipment supporting 40GbE optical connectivity.
Yes. This module operates over single-mode fiber infrastructure using an MPO-12 optical connector. It is commonly used in enterprise fiber backbones and structured data center cabling environments.
The optical design supports reliable signal transmission up to 2 kilometers over single-mode fiber. This makes it suitable for campus networks, building interconnects, and medium-distance data center links.
No. The module operates with controlled power consumption, allowing stable thermal behavior even inside high-density switch environments where multiple QSFP+ modules are installed.
Yes. Many network architects deploy this module for spine-leaf topologies, especially when connecting leaf switches to aggregation or spine switches across medium-distance fiber links.
PLR4 modules typically use parallel CWDM optical channels and MPO connectors, while LR4 modules operate using duplex LC fiber connections. PLR4 modules are common in structured fiber infrastructure within large data centers.
